Aylesbury Ladies 2nd XI 2-1 Rickmansworth 1st XI

Despite fielding a team of young newcomers to the second team this week, Aylesbury matched up to the mature Rickmansworth team with confidence. Taking the game to the opposition, they quickly won possession and outmanoeuvred them with deft passing and quick turns.

As the game progressed, both teams were afforded chances to take the lead. Acrobatic diving from keeper Karen Munson kept Rickmansworth at bay, while the driving force of player of the match Tiz Brooks and Zoe Collin upset midfield. A few opportunities, however, were lost in the striking 'D' and, just before half-time, a scramble in the defensive 'D' saw Rickmansworth take a lucky lead.

Undeterred, Aylesbury changed into an attacking formation for the second half, sure they could still win the game. The appearance of Emily Penson gave some much needed fresh legs to the forward line, supported by the midfield youngsters Beth Forrest, Tilly Ray and Clemmie Jackson - all of whom grew in confidence and skill as the match wore on.

Eventually, Aylesbury was rewarded for its relentless attacks with a pass across the face of the goal to the waiting stick of Mel Rose on the back post who leathered the ball into the net. Spirits raised, the home team continued pressuring the Rickmansworth defence, with captain Liz Brooks and Robyn Dunne easily passing the ball around the 'D' until a short corner was won from a mistimed tackle. The ball was slipped wide to Tiz Brooks who flicked the ball into the side netting, taking Aylesbury into the lead with ten minutes to go.

With a mind on keeping the lead, Aylesbury battened down the hatches and defended solidly against a desperate Rickmansworth fighting to pull it back to a draw. Debutant Lauren King outplayed her winger to drive counter-attacks up the left, while workhorse Ann Davis didn't give her mark an inch of space to make a competent shot. The final whistle eventually came and Aylesbury had won a hard-fought battle against an equal opposition.
